- What was the inspiration for the Foodies Books?
I was an early years development person for years and kids from thelocal school used to come over to my veggie patch. I was shocked whenone of them asked where the strawberries were, in December. I wanted torecapture the magic of seasonal food. I'm not a purist but food is lessexpensive, more environmentally friendly and above all, tastes betterwhen it's in season.
- What has the reception from children been like?
They love it. Each month stars a different vegetable. First they readthe story of the vegetable, then how to grow it, meet it and eat it.Everything is based on making healthy snacks interesting.
